His ghost comes back to be remembered. If he can't be in this life, he procures a way to stay in orbit, and in that way, is never forgotten.

This quote delves into the enduring nature of memory and how the human desire for legacy persists beyond physical absence. When someone passes away or is no longer physically present, the desire to be remembered remains incredibly powerful. The metaphor of a ghost symbolizes not just the lingering presence of a person's memory but also the idea that even when their corporeal form is gone, their essence continues to exist in the minds and hearts of others. The phrase "if he can't be in this life" suggests a recognition of mortality and the inevitable separation from the physical realm, yet the individual finds a way to maintain a form of immortality—by "staying in orbit." Here, orbit can be interpreted as a space of perpetual remembrance, possibly through stories, achievements, or impact that keeps their spirit alive in ongoing cycles of memory. This reflects a poignant truth about human culture: we seek everlasting connection, and through remembrance, individuals achieve a form of immortality. It hints at the comfort and significance found in becoming part of something greater than oneself—culture, history, or collective memory—that ensures they are never truly forgotten. The concept also encourages us to reflect on how we preserve the memories of others in our lives, knowing that even in their physical absence, their influence continues to resonate, much like celestial bodies in perpetual motion. Ultimately, this quote underscores a universal truth about the importance of remembrance and the ways humans find to inscribe their legacy into the fabric of life, even after death.
